David Walton left this review about Harvester Beech Hurst
Visited 08/07/26. Visited previously 02/12/23
No cask. Keg offering of Carling, Madri, Peroni, Stella, Wingman, Guinness, dark fruits SB, Inch's.
Popular Harvester. Bar counter is to the right of the entrance, initially tiled, then bare boards, apart from a tile skirt along the bar counter. Seating for the bar comprises a few tall tables between the entrance and the bar counter and opposite the bar counter, with a couple of regular tables served by regular chairs and a small corner fitted banquette. There is a larger booth table the other side of the far end of the bar counter that isn’t laid for diners and so presumably available if a large group of drinkers turned up at this obvious destination drinking hole! No screens and no piped music, just the chatter of diners. The pure dining areas are large and expansive all around the bar counter and there ample outside dining areas also available.

Just a quick pint, then I'm off left this review about Harvester The Beech Hurst
Substantial Harvester chain pub / restaurant, but it does at least have a couple of noteworthy features. Firstly, the rear terrace backs directly onto Beech Hurst park with no boundary fence so youngsters can go off and play without disrupting other visitors, and it has a continental-style sunken courtyard dining area with a colonnade on all four sides. That aside, it's all dull stuff inside, including the keg-only draught beer selection, so I had a quick Peroni (£3.35, half) in the Spring sunshine.

Strongers . left this review about Harvester The Beech Hurst
This is a huge Harvester, in fact I think it is the biggest one I’ve been in and it was very busy on a Saturday evening a couple of weeks ago. The bar, to the right of the entrance, is stocked with standard and premium keg. This bar faces a huge square open plan seating area and then there is more seating around to the right rear. Out the back there is seating next to some tennis courts, which it turns out are on Beech Hurst Gardens. This place serves a purpose, but I don’t love it so I’ll not be returning.
